The Importance of Rod and Reel Combinations
The rod and reel serve as the vital link between the angler and the fish. Different rod actions (light, medium, heavy) are designed for various fish sizes and fighting styles. A light rod is excellent for panfish, providing sensitivity to detect subtle bites. A heavy rod, on the other hand, is more suitable for battling larger species. The reel’s gear ratio also plays a critical role – a lower gear ratio provides more power for reeling in heavy fish, while a higher gear ratio allows for faster line retrieval. Choosing the right combination is a strategic element that can dramatically influence success. Paying attention to these details allows players to tailor their approach to the specific challenges the game presents.
Line and Lure Selection Strategies
Beyond rods and reels, the line and lure selection is paramount in attracting and securing a catch. Monofilament, fluorocarbon, and braided lines all offer distinct advantages. Monofilament is known for its affordability and stretch, while fluorocarbon is nearly invisible in the water, making it ideal for wary fish. Braided lines possess incredible strength. Lure choices are endlessly diverse, ranging from lively minnows to brightly colored jigs and spoons. The design of the lure impacts its action in the water, attracting different species and influencing their behavior. Experimentation is crucial, but understanding the preferences of the target fish is critical for achieving consistent results.
